Error while using sqlwrite - String data, right truncation

Hello, I am using the database toolbox, and I want to add a database to an already existing database on Microsoft SQL server.
However, I get this error:
Error using database.odbc.connection/sqlwrite (line 214)
ODBC JDBC/ODBC Error: ODBC Driver Error: [Microsoft][SQL Server Native Client 11.0]String data, right truncation.
Error in write2db (line 15)
sqlwrite(Conn, TableName, Table)
FYI, the number of columns are the same. I don't know if it is due to heavy strings or not.

I wonder if one of the fields you are trying to write is a string object or character vector (or, more likely, cell array of character vectors), and if the field was defined as a fixed width, and you are trying to write something wider than was allocated?

Thank you for your answers. The problem wat that there was a longer string than the maximum length defined for a specific column.
